Eliminating the High-Volume Bottleneck

The absolute worst element of large-scale student events is a slow-moving queue. If you force an active, dressed-up crowd to stand in a rigid line for 30 minutes just to squeeze three people at a time into a cramped box, your event’s energy drops instantly.

Modern open-air digital kiosks solve this operational nightmare through structural minimalism. Built entirely without walls or heavy curtains, these freestanding units operate as wide-angle photography stations.

Because the activation is completely open to the room, it functions as a highly visible piece of performance art. Passing guests can see the fun happening in real time, which naturally builds hype. More importantly, it eliminates physical restrictions entirely. Your entire student society committee, a massive sports club team, or a group of twenty friends can seamlessly jump into a single frame together. The shutter clicks, the crowd cheers, and the line clears in a fraction of the time required by traditional setups.

Frictionless Digital Delivery in Seconds

Today’s generation of university students has zero patience for analog technology. While a printed paper photo strip is a fun vintage souvenir, it is highly impractical at a massive gala. Paper strips are easily lost, damaged by spilled drinks on cocktail tables, or ruined on the dance floor. Furthermore, waiting for a mechanical printer to slowly heat up and process paper kills the momentum of a fast-moving night.

Our commercial-grade digital kiosks are engineered specifically for rapid, frictionless digital gratification. The moment a group completes its session, they approach a responsive touchscreen interface. By scanning a custom, instantly generated QR code with their smartphones or entering their mobile numbers via SMS, the high-resolution files are transferred directly to their devices in real time.

There is no waiting, no mechanical delay, and no paper waste. Attendees can capture their high-definition photos, dynamic GIFs, or high-energy boomerangs and instantly drop them onto their social channels before they even step away from the booth.

Studio-Grade Lighting for Grand Scale Spaces

The Crown Palladium is famous for its soaring seven-meter ceilings and magnificent custom chandeliers. While this grand scale creates an incredible sense of luxury, it also presents a massive lighting challenge for amateur photography. The sweeping ambient light that makes the ballroom look majestic in person is incredibly difficult for standard smartphone cameras to process. Selfies taken on the move are almost always plagued by grainy textures, low-resolution blur, and awkward shadows.

Our open-air stations function as miniaturized, professional photography studios designed to dominate massive event spaces. Packed with high-resolution DSLR sensors and surrounded by high-output, calibrated ring flashes, they flood subjects with soft, wrap-around light. This studio-grade illumination instantly smooths skin tones, eliminates harsh venue shadows, and highlights the premium details of every tuxedo and ball gown, providing your guests with editorial-quality portraits they will value forever.
